Back in Time To You

Amanda thought she was born this way, to be betrayed, and end up like a fool who doesn't know what it is to live like a powerful person. She only dreamed of living a simple life with Edmund, her fiancée. However, she didn't expect to be betrayed by someone she'd loved. She's lost everything but the precious ring her mother had given her. Knowing she couldn't let them have their way, she swallowed the ring before plunging to her death. However, she didn't expect to wake up in her room after her death. As she continues, she will be facing the same plot of her life. However, she will change it into a brand new life. But, as she goes on turning the tables. She will be encountering unexpected events that will make her change.
